Kinepolis Adding Six CJ 4DPlex 4DX Theatres

Tue, 11/13/2018 - 11:48 -- Nick Dager

CJ 4DPlex announced today an agreement with Kinepolis to bring the 4DX immersive-seat experience to six additional Kinepolis cinema complexes. Less than one year after the opening of its first 4DX theatres in Antwerp, Brussels, Lomme, Madrid and Valencia, the company has announced six additional 4DX theatres, which include three in Belgium (Kinepolis Hasselt, Ghent and Rocourt), one in Luxembourg (Kirchberg), one in France (Kinepolis Nîmes) and one in Spain (Kinepolis Diversia, Madrid).

4DX Tops $250 Million in 2018 Ticket Sales to Date

Tue, 11/06/2018 - 11:12 -- Nick Dager

CJ 4DPlex has reached new levels of success with more than 20 million worldwide attendees and $250 million at the box office to date in 2018. The company anticipates that the total number of moviegoers who have experienced 4DX since its launch in 2009 will exceed 85 million by year’s end, with the total box office gross surpassing $1 billion.

Christie Helps Bring the Bedford Playhouse to Life

Wed, 10/31/2018 - 10:55 -- Nick Dager

Christie cinema projectors illuminated all three screens for the September grand opening of New York State’s newly renovated, historic Bedford Playhouse. The original Playhouse first opened its doors in April 1947, and 70 years later the total audio/visual design and installation phase for the new complex was awarded to Digital Media Systems, a valued Christie business partner, as part of the construction of the new facility that began in spring 2017.

Immersive Rooms

Mon, 10/29/2018 - 12:36 -- Nick Dager

One of the biggest technology trends in motion picture exhibition today is immersive seating. Several companies have successfully partnered with exhibitors, movie studies and other producers to create an audience experience that actively mirrors the sights, sounds, actions and aromas of the movie on the screen. MediaMation is unique among these companies because not only are the seats in an MX4D theatre designed for movement and effects, the entire room is.
